IMO, maybe because doing vertical jump, you get more preparation and time.. because your aim is to reach highest point possible right?
but in badminton, got less time to prepare jump, no point jump to the highest when you going to miss the shuttle. I don't think you will have enough time to move to under the shuttle, preparing to jump then jump as high as possible all the time. unless you have lightning footwork.
btw how to calculate the jump height? i was thinkin standing and try to reach highest point possible, then jump and try to reach the highest point possible and just subtract them. because if I calc from foot, standing then jump + bend my knee it won't be accurate right?
